Abstract

Nuclear transparencies for the fundamental process γnπp on He4 and O16 have been calculated using nucleon configurations obtained from realistic ground-state wave functions by the Monte Carlo method. Comparisons between nuclear transparency results using nucleon configurations and the correlated Glauber approximation are made in the case of (e,ep) on He4 and O16. Furthermore, nuclear transparencies for the γnπp and (e,ep) processes have been calculated including a color transparency effect. © 1996 The American Physical Society.
